First of all, the 12-point or 6-point debate is only relevant if you are dealing with already damaged fasteners. If your stuff is in good shape, you're going to snap the bolt before rounding the head.

Second of all, you're probably not going to find box end wrenches like this in 6-point. And if you could, they would be very limited in usefulness due to the huge swing angle needed to use and reposition them.
